Electrical Wiring Residential uses a practical approach and comprehensive coverage to guide your students through the critical tasks and responsibilities needed to comply with the 2011 National Electrical Code®. Containing coverage of energy conservation laws like Title 24, as well as illustrations that are coordinated with the latest NEC® regulations, and a new chapter on Solar Photovoltaic Systems, this is an ideal resource for your students who will work in the residential electrical industry.
Electrical Wiring Residential also contains complete sets of plans that offer students opportunities for hands-on practice in interpreting and applying Code requirements, and uses real-world examples throughout to reinforce key calculations and concepts.
The book also uses both metric and English measurements to appeal to students of all learning backgrounds, and contains a Code Cross-Index that allows students to easily reference specific content and Code requirements.
